A West Virginia House Concurrent Resolution to designate the second Friday in July as West Virginia Collector Car Appreciation Day was approved by the Roads and Transportation Committee. The bill will now be considered in a vote by the full House of Delegates. For the past five years, the U.S. Senate has passed a similar resolution, at SEMA’s request, to acknowledge the day’s significance in raising awareness of the vital role automotive restoration and collection plays in American society.
